>> The problem here is that you could get a GNUTLS_E_REAUTH_REQUEST
>> exception in the middle of a read from an I/O ports.  This breaks
>> abstraction because the caller of that read call may not know that the
>> port happens to be a GnuTLS record port.
>
> That should be similar to GNUTLS_E_REHANDSHAKE error. I'm not sure if
> that can be the right solution but there is the option of
> GNUTLS_AUTO_REAUTH.

Indeed, GNUTLS_AUTO_REAUTH looks like a simple solution.
